Abstract
Peer-to-Peer computing has evolved over the last few years and is applied to a rising number of applications. Following this development we present a decentralised approach to dynamically select, load and integrate peer-to-peer based services into a CORBA-compliant middleware. This is achieved by extending and improving the mechanisms for dynamic service integration of JXTA an open peer-to-peer infrastructure. At object level we build on the fragmented object model provided by the AspectIX middleware to seamlessly integrate and use peer-to-peer services instead of common CORBA client/server-based implementations.
